Dive into the Silent Realm: A Guide to Deep Sleep Mastery
Unveil the mysteries of deep sleep and elevate your well-being. This journey will guide you through proven techniques to unlock the rewards of restful slumber. Develop a consistent sleep routine that synchronizes with your natural rhythms.
Embrace meditation practices to calm your thoughts. Create a tranquil sleep atmosphere by tuning factors like climate, lighting, and audio.
Stress the importance of a healthy way of living that supports quality sleep. Add habitual exercise, a nutritious diet, and limit caffeine before bedtime.

The Power of Deep Sleep: Transforming Your Life Through Restful Nights
Deep sleep plays a crucial role in our overall well-being. It’s during these quiet hours that our bodies and minds repair. When we consistently get enough deep sleep, we experience a cascade of positive effects. Our energy levels spike, our cognitive function boosts, and our mood lifts.
On the other hand, chronic sleep deprivation can have here detrimental consequences. It can lead to weakened concentration, increased stress levels, and even a higher risk of chronic diseases. So how can we prioritize deep sleep and unlock its transformative power?
* Cultivate a relaxing bedtime routine
* Create a sleep-conducive environment
* Limit screen time before bed
* Avoid caffeine and alcohol in the evening
* Engage in regular physical activity
By making these simple changes, you can improve your sleep quality and experience the incredible benefits of deep, restful nights.
